Billet Labs Unveils The Boiler: A Steampunk-Inspired RTX 4090 Gaming PC

Article Highlights
Off On

Billet Labs has captured the essence of steampunk aesthetics with their latest creation, “The Boiler,” a compact, custom-built gaming PC powered by the formidable Nvidia RTX 4090 Founders Edition GPU. With meticulous attention to detail, this unique rig incorporates intricate copper piping and water cooling, exploiting copper’s notable thermal conductivity to ensure peak performance.

Inside this bespoke machine lies a powerhouse of components, including an AMD Ryzen 7 9800X3D processor, 64GB of RAM, and 12TB of SSD storage. These top-tier specifications ensure that “The Boiler” delivers unparalleled gaming experiences alongside seamless multitasking capabilities. The design elements further emphasize its steampunk roots, with cylindrical pipes, valves, and fittings that mimic the appearance of a steam engine. Initially previewed through a TikTok video, the PC’s operation was later confirmed on Instagram. A comprehensive build walkthrough is anticipated to premiere on YouTube, providing an in-depth look at the creative process behind this technological masterpiece.

Beyond being a visual and technical statement, “The Boiler” is set to make a significant impact beyond the gaming realm. Billet Labs has announced plans to auction this steampunk-inspired rig, with proceeds benefiting charity.
